Philippe Humeau founded CrowdSec in 2020, where they got to work on their open-source massively multi-player firewall which utilises IP behaviour AND reputation to help tackle mass scale hacking. Listen in as he talks about the benefits of actual collaboration, the human side of security and some brilliant stories. In this episode, Jenny is joined by Professor Tiziana Casciaro, author, speaker and academic in the field of organisational behaviour. They discuss her latest book "Power for all" and how this contributes to organisational theory and culture. In this fascinating conversation, they also chat about how power and ego are nuanced and unique and ponder the application of the theories in fields such as politics and the workplace. In this interview Jenny speaks with Robert Brooker who is the Chairman of the London Fraud Forum and Head of Fraud and Forensics at PKF. We discuss how fraudsters adapted to the pandemic, the damage caused to victims as well as the motivation and psychology of those who commit this type of crime.
